Amana Tool 46272 Solid Carbide CNC Foam Up-Cut Cutting Square End Spiral 1/4 Dia x 2-1/4 x 1/4 Shank x 2-1/2 Inch Long Router Bit

SKU: 46272

Direction: Up-Cut
(D) Diameter: 1/4"
(B) Cutting Height: 2-1/4"
(d) Shank: 1/4"
(L) Overall Length: 4"
Flutes: 2

Ensure your foam projects are milled with unparalleled accuracy detail and clarity. Achieve both precision and depth for foam carving and milling applications. Provides deeper cuts and larger slices with fewer passes in thick materials resulting in improved productivity and less assembly. The up-cut spiral ejects chips away from the workpiece.

Specifically designed for milling:

  • Crosslinked Polyethylene Foam (XLPE)
  • Ethafoam**
  • Ethylene-vinyl Acetate Foam (EVA)
  • Expanded Polypropylene (EPP)*
  • Expanded Polystyrene (EPS)
  • Extruded Polystyrene Foam (XPS)
  • Flexible Polyurethane Foam (FPF)
  • Fomex®
  • High-Density-Urethane (HUD Board)
  • PALFOAM™
  • Polycarbonate (Lexan™)
  • Polyethylene Foam**
  • Polylam**
  • Polyurethane Foam

*Expanded polypropylene (EPP) is a foam form of polypropylene.


**Ethafoam Polyethylene and Polylam are durable flexible closed-cell foams with excellent memory.

Recommendation: Use the slowest suggested feed rates and the shortest bits necessary for cutting and routing Lexan™.

For thick material with up-cut chip removal. For 2D & 3D CNC routing applications.
